How to Master Blockchain in 2025: A Comprehensive Guide for Aspiring Experts
Introduction
Blockchain technology has evolved into a pivotal force in reshaping industries worldwide, from revolutionizing financial systems to improving healthcare and beyond. By 2025, gaining proficiency in blockchain is no longer optional but an essential skill for thriving in the rapidly transforming digital economy. This guide provides an in-depth roadmap for college students and professionals eager to dive into blockchain technology, equipping them with the theoretical and practical tools necessary for success.
What's Discussed in This Article:
-
Introduction to Blockchain
- Importance of mastering blockchain in 2025
- Blockchain's impact on industries and the digital economy
-
Blockchain Basics
- Explanation of blockchain technology and its core concepts
- Key benefits: security, transparency, efficiency, and global impact
-
Types of Blockchains
- Public, private, permissioned, and consortium blockchains
- Use cases and differences between these types
-
Essential Tools and Platforms
- Popular platforms like Ethereum, Hyperledger Fabric, and Binance Smart Chain
- Tools for beginners, including MetaMask, Remix IDE, and Blockchain Explorer
-
Learning Resources
- Online courses, books, and community forums for mastering blockchain
- Recommended resources for beginners and intermediate learners
-
Real-World Applications
- Use cases in finance, supply chain, healthcare, and governance
- Examples of successful blockchain projects like IBM Food Trust and Ripple
-
Getting Started with Blockchain Development
- Key programming languages: Solidity, JavaScript, Python, and Rust
- Steps to start developing decentralized applications (DApps)
-
Overcoming Challenges
- Common barriers: complexity, security, regulations, and learning curve
- Tips for success and continuous growth in the blockchain field
-
Future Trends in Blockchain
- Predictions for scalability, AI integration, and energy-efficient solutions
- Emerging technologies like NFTs, quantum computing, and interoperability
-
Call to Action
- Encouragement to start learning blockchain today
- Suggestions for further exploration and staying updated with trends
This article serves as a comprehensive roadmap for anyone looking to dive into blockchain technology in 2025 and beyond.
Understanding Blockchain Foundations
Defining Blockchain Technology
At its core, blockchain is a decentralized, distributed ledger technology that records transactions transparently and immutably across a network of nodes. Each "block" in the chain contains data, a timestamp, and a cryptographic hash of the previous block, ensuring that the information is tamper-proof. This structure fosters trust by decentralizing control, making it nearly impossible to alter records without network consensus.
The Importance of Blockchain in 2025
- Unmatched Security:
Blockchain’s cryptographic algorithms provide a robust defense against cyber threats and unauthorized access. - Enhanced Transparency:
Every transaction is openly verifiable, fostering accountability across systems. - Operational Efficiency:
By eliminating intermediaries, blockchain reduces costs and streamlines processes. - Global Relevance:
From revolutionizing supply chains to enabling decentralized finance, blockchain continues to impact diverse sectors, making expertise in this field invaluable.
Core Concepts to Master
- Blocks and Chains:
Understanding the structure and linkage of data. - Nodes:
Distributed participants maintaining and verifying the blockchain network. - Consensus Algorithms:
Mechanisms like Proof of Work (PoW) and Proof of Stake (PoS) for transaction validation. - Smart Contracts:
Self-executing contracts with predefined conditions, enabling automation.
Exploring Blockchain Varieties
Types of Blockchain Networks
- Public Blockchains:
Decentralized systems open to anyone, with examples like Bitcoin and Ethereum leading the charge. - Private Blockchains:
Restricted-access networks tailored for organizational use, ensuring privacy and control. - Permissioned Blockchains:
Merging public accessibility with controlled participation, these blockchains balance transparency with security. - Consortium Blockchains:
Governed collaboratively by multiple organizations, promoting industry-wide cooperation and standardization.
Essential Platforms and Tools
Prominent Blockchain Platforms
- Ethereum:
A trailblazer in decentralized applications (DApps) and smart contract development. - Hyperledger Fabric:
A modular framework designed for scalable, enterprise-grade applications. - Solana:
Known for its high-speed and low-cost transactions, optimized for performance-intensive projects. - Binance Smart Chain (BSC):
A cost-effective platform compatible with Ethereum tools.
Recommended Tools for Beginners
- MetaMask:
A browser extension for managing Ethereum wallets and interacting with DApps. - Remix IDE:
An accessible platform for learning Solidity and developing smart contracts. - Ganache:
A personal blockchain for running tests, executing commands, and inspecting states. - Etherscan:
A blockchain explorer that provides insights into transactions, contracts, and network analytics.
Learning Resources for Mastery
Online Platforms and Courses
- Coursera:
Offers a "Blockchain Specialization" series by top universities with hands-on projects. - edX:
Features advanced blockchain courses, including technical and business applications. - Simplilearn:
Provides professional certifications tailored for aspiring blockchain developers.
Must-Read Books
- Mastering Bitcoin by Andreas M. Antonopoulos: A detailed exploration of Bitcoin’s technical architecture.
- Blockchain Basics by Daniel Drescher: Ideal for beginners with no prior technical background.
- Blockchain Revolution by Don and Alex Tapscott: Discusses blockchain’s impact on industries and society.
Engaging with Communities
- GitHub: Participate in collaborative open-source blockchain projects.
- Reddit: Engage in active discussions on forums like r/blockchain.
- Discord and Telegram: Join channels dedicated to blockchain development and networking.
Practical Applications of Blockchain Technology
Industry Use Cases
- Finance:
Facilitates secure, low-cost cross-border payments and innovative decentralized finance (DeFi) platforms. - Healthcare:
Secures patient records and streamlines access to medical data. - Supply Chains:
Enhances transparency and traceability, reducing inefficiencies and fraud. - Governance:
Enables tamper-proof voting systems and transparent public record management.
Noteworthy Projects
- IBM Food Trust:
Ensures traceability in global food supply chains. - Ripple (XRP):
Simplifies international remittances with fast, low-cost transactions. - Chainlink:
Provides reliable off-chain data for blockchain smart contracts through decentralized oracles.
Building Blockchain Development Skills
Programming Languages to Learn
- Solidity:
Essential for Ethereum smart contract development. - Python:
Widely used for scripting blockchain-related applications. - JavaScript:
Facilitates integration of blockchain with web interfaces. - Rust:
Powers high-performance blockchains like Solana.
Kickstarting Development Projects
- Choose a blockchain platform suited to your interests (e.g., Ethereum or BSC).
- Master the basics of writing and deploying smart contracts.
- Experiment on testnets to develop decentralized applications (DApps).
- Engage in hackathons and online challenges to build real-world skills.
Addressing Common Challenges
Barriers for Beginners
- Complex Concepts:
Blockchain demands understanding cryptographic principles and decentralized systems. - Security Concerns:
Requires learning secure coding practices to mitigate vulnerabilities. - Evolving Regulations:
Stay informed about compliance and legal implications. - Continuous Learning:
The fast pace of innovation necessitates ongoing education.
Tips for Overcoming Hurdles
- Break complex topics into smaller, manageable lessons.
- Leverage free and premium online resources for structured learning.
- Network with peers and mentors to share knowledge and receive guidance.
- Stay curious and open to experimenting with new tools and frameworks.
Blockchain’s Future Trajectory
Trends for 2025 and Beyond
- Scalability Enhancements:
Adoption of layer-2 solutions like Polygon and Optimism. - Blockchain-AI Integration:
Facilitating automated decision-making and fraud detection. - Sustainability Focus:
Transitioning to eco-friendly consensus mechanisms. - Mainstream Adoption:
Applications in identity verification, asset tokenization, and more.
Emerging Technologies
- Quantum Computing:
A challenge and opportunity for blockchain security. - Interoperability Protocols:
Ensuring seamless communication between blockchain networks. - NFTs and the Metaverse:
Expanding possibilities for digital ownership and virtual economies.
Call to Action
Embark on your blockchain journey today by diving into the resources and tools outlined in this guide. Take your first steps by experimenting with blockchain platforms, joining online communities, and building your foundational skills. Share your progress and insights with peers to foster collaborative learning and growth.
Stay updated with the latest trends in blockchain innovation by subscribing to our newsletter, where we share breaking news, expert opinions, and actionable tips. Don’t stop here—explore other transformative topics that complement your blockchain knowledge.
Check out our beginner-friendly articles on Artificial Intelligence, Quantum Computing, and Neuromorphic Computing to broaden your understanding of cutting-edge technologies. If you're looking for practical advice, dive into our popular guides on making money online through tech innovations.
By mastering blockchain and connecting it with advancements in AI and other frontier technologies, you can position yourself at the forefront of the digital revolution. Be a pioneer in shaping the future of technology, and make your mark in the evolving global landscape.
Conclusion
Blockchain technology holds the potential to redefine industries and empower individuals. By dedicating yourself to understanding its intricacies and applying your knowledge, you can establish a strong foundation for a career in this transformative field. Stay proactive, embrace continuous learning, and let curiosity guide your journey toward blockchain mastery.